#include <glibmm.h>
#include <iomanip>
#include <iostream>
namespace
{
void
file_get_contents(const std::string& filename, Glib::ustring& contents)
{
const auto channel = Glib::IOChannel::create_from_file(filename, "r");
channel->read_to_end(contents);
}
Glib::ustring
trim_whitespace(const Glib::ustring& text)
{
Glib::ustring::const_iterator pbegin(text.begin());
Glib::ustring::const_iterator pend(text.end());
while (pbegin != pend && Glib::Unicode::isspace(*pbegin))
++pbegin;
Glib::ustring::const_iterator temp(pend);
while (pbegin != temp && Glib::Unicode::isspace(*--temp))
pend = temp;
return Glib::ustring(pbegin, pend);
}
class DumpParser : public Glib::Markup::Parser
{
public:
DumpParser();
~DumpParser() override;
protected:
void on_start_element(Glib::Markup::ParseContext& context, const Glib::ustring& element_name,
const AttributeMap& attributes) override;
void on_end_element(
Glib::Markup::ParseContext& context, const Glib::ustring& element_name) override;
void on_text(Glib::Markup::ParseContext& context, const Glib::ustring& text) override;
private:
int parse_depth_;
void indent();
};
DumpParser::DumpParser() : parse_depth_(0)
{
}
DumpParser::~DumpParser()
{
}
void
DumpParser::on_start_element(
Glib::Markup::ParseContext&, const Glib::ustring& element_name, const AttributeMap& attributes)
{
indent();
std::cout << '<' << element_name;
for (const auto& p : attributes)
{
std::cout << ' ' << p.first << "=\"" << p.second << '"';
}
std::cout << ">\n";
++parse_depth_;
}
void
DumpParser::on_end_element(Glib::Markup::ParseContext&, const Glib::ustring& element_name)
{
--parse_depth_;
indent();
std::cout << "</" << element_name << ">\n";
}
void
DumpParser::on_text(Glib::Markup::ParseContext&, const Glib::ustring& text)
{
const Glib::ustring trimmed_text = trim_whitespace(text);
if (!trimmed_text.empty())
{
indent();
std::cout << trimmed_text << '\n';
}
}
void
DumpParser::indent()
{
if (parse_depth_ > 0)
{
std::cout << std::setw(4 * parse_depth_)
/* gcc 2.95.3 doesn't like this: << std::right */
<< ' ';
}
}
} // anonymous namespace
int
main(int argc, char** argv)
{
if (argc < 2)
{
std::cerr << "Usage: parser filename\n";
return 1;
}
DumpParser parser;
Glib::Markup::ParseContext context(parser);
try
{
Glib::ustring contents;
file_get_contents(argv[1], contents);
context.parse(contents);
context.end_parse();
}
catch (const Glib::Error& error)
{
std::cerr << argv[1] << ": " << error.what() << std::endl;
return 1;
}
return 0;
}
